What causes cellulite?
Cellulite is caused by fat pushing against connective tissue beneath the skin, creating a dimpled appearance.
Can cellulite be completely removed?
Treatments reduce visibility significantly, but no method can guarantee complete and permanent removal.
How many sessions are needed?
Most patients need 4–8 sessions depending on cellulite severity.
Is cellulite treatment painful?
No, most treatments cause only mild discomfort and are well tolerated.
Are results permanent?
Results are long-lasting, though lifestyle factors like weight gain or aging may cause recurrence.
Which areas can be treated?
Common areas include thighs, buttocks, abdomen, and hips.

Cellulite occurs when fat deposits push through the connective tissue beneath the skin, creating a dimpled or lumpy surface. It is influenced by multiple factors, including genetics, hormonal changes, lifestyle, and aging. Contrary to popular belief, cellulite is not always linked to weight. Even individuals with a healthy body mass index (BMI) can develop it, and it can worsen with time as skin elasticity decreases.

At Erdem Hospital, specialists offer a comprehensive range of treatments tailored to the individual needs of each patient. These therapies address cellulite at its source, targeting fat deposits, connective tissue, and skin quality.
Laser treatments use heat energy to break down fat cells, stimulate collagen, and release fibrous bands beneath the skin. This leads to smoother contours and firmer skin. Fractional lasers are particularly effective for moderate to severe cellulite.
RF energy heats deep layers of the skin, improving circulation and stimulating collagen production. This enhances elasticity and reduces the visibility of dimples. Combined RF and ultrasound systems offer even greater precision and results.
Also known as shockwave therapy, this method uses sound waves to break up fibrous tissue and improve blood flow. Over time, it reduces cellulite and enhances skin texture.
For patients with deeper cellulite, minimally invasive subcision is used to release fibrous bands that cause dimpling. This allows the skin to smooth out naturally.
Certain injectable solutions can break down fat and stimulate tissue remodeling, reducing cellulite and tightening skin. These are often used in combination with other therapies for best results.
By delivering vitamins, minerals, and enzymes directly into the skin, mesotherapy improves hydration, circulation, and firmness, which helps reduce the visibility of cellulite.

The process begins with a detailed consultation. Specialists assess the type and severity of cellulite, skin condition, and overall health. Patients share their goals, and a tailored treatment plan is developed to meet their unique needs.
Depending on the chosen therapy, sessions may last between 30 minutes and an hour. Most treatments are performed on an outpatient basis with minimal discomfort. Multiple sessions are usually recommended for optimal results.
Non-surgical treatments typically require little to no downtime. Patients may experience mild redness, swelling, or tenderness, but these effects resolve quickly. Clear aftercare instructions are provided, including guidance on skincare and activity levels.
Results become visible gradually as collagen production increases and tissues remodel. Many patients notice improvements after a few sessions, with final results appearing over several months. The improvements are long-lasting, particularly when combined with healthy lifestyle habits.
